    we came to cala banana and nodu pianu in the late mornung time of our last day in sardinia for this year. because our airplane left late in the evening we had still enough time to spend one last day on the beach. we choosed cala banana and nodu pianu, because we could visite two beaches at the same place...that was nice.
    it was also nice, that the distance to the airport only was 7 kilometers and so we could stay till the early evening. the beach is easy reachable by car, a big parking place is located directly behind the beach...we didn´t pay any fee.
    after a short walk we arrived cala banana, which is located in the northpart of the bay. a small marina with tiny boats is located in the stoney middlepart of the bay...then nodu pianu begins. both beaches are maybe 180 meters long and slope gently to the sea, so these places are perfect for families with small children.
    the water is crystalclear and the ground partly stoney...specially near the small marina...there the water gets faster deep also.
    the reflections of the clean water reach from green to blue in every presentable shade and it made a lot of fun to slash and swim.
    a beachbar is located where it is also possible to take a shower and rent parasols and longchairs. about the prices we can´t give any information.
    we can recomment the both beaches very much. we had a great day there. the atmosphere was relaxed and peaceful. a nice place to let dangle the soul.
